Teach Kids the Value of Money

value money

Teaching younger kids the value of money through real life situations will help them understand where money comes from and how it’s earned. Sort My Money’s David Rankin believes that talking to children about money when shopping, paying bills, going to an ATM, and budgeting is a great way to teach them good money habits. When kids grow in a financially responsible environment, it becomes a part of their nature and it influences their decision-making as adults. Don’t Spend Your Money on Stuff You Don’t Need

sale

Sale items should not be an invitation to spend your money on stuff you don’t need. Don’t merely buy items just because of the discounted price. Ensure they’re part of your weekly meal plan or something you know you’re going to use. If you are shopping for food, consider gradually swapping a few items for their cheaper counterparts, and you just might be surprised by how much you save.
